PDF to CSV: The Ultimate Guide to Efficient Data Extraction

Lianne Aurora
Written By Lianne Aurora
Table of Contents
What Are PDF and CSV Formats?
Reasons to Convert Data to CSV Format
Methods to Convert PDF to CSV
Step-by-Step Guide: How to Convert PDF to CSV
Boost Your Productivity with Smallppt
Tips for Accurate PDF to CSV Conversion
FAQs
Conclusion
PDF to CSV: The Ultimate Guide to Efficient Data Extraction
Smallppt
2026-04-21 17:49:06

Businesses and individuals often need to convert a PDF to CSV to make information more usable and actionable. PDFs are great for sharing and preserving formatting, but they are not ideal for analyzing or editing data.

Common scenarios include extracting financial data, processing reports, or converting bank statements to CSV for budgeting and accounting. This leads to a common question: how do you convert a PDF to a CSV file quickly and accurately?

With the rise of AI-powered tools, document workflows have become significantly more efficient. Modern solutions now make it easier than ever to turn a PDF into CSV with minimal effort and high accuracy.

What Are PDF and CSV Formats?

A PDF (Portable Document Format) is a fixed-layout file format designed to maintain consistent formatting across devices. While this makes it excellent for sharing documents, it limits data manipulation.

On the other hand, a CSV (Comma-Separated Values) file is a simple, structured format that stores tabular data. It is widely supported by tools like Excel, Google Sheets, and databases.

This is why many organizations prefer working with PDFs rather than CSVs—it transforms static documents into flexible, editable datasets.

Reasons to Convert Data to CSV Format

There are several compelling reasons to convert data to CSV format, especially for businesses and data professionals:

Reasons to Convert Data to CSV Format
  • Easier data analysis and manipulation: CSV files allow you to sort, filter, and analyze data efficiently.
  • Compatibility with popular tools: CSV works seamlessly with Excel, Google Sheets, and database systems.
  • Automation and integration: CSV files are ideal for workflows involving APIs, scripts, and automation tools.
  • Financial data processing: Tasks like converting a bank statement to CSV, free conversion, make it easier to track expenses and manage accounts.

Methods to Convert PDF to CSV

There are several ways to convert a PDF file to CSV, depending on the complexity of your document and your technical needs.

1. Manual Conversion

The simplest method is to copy-paste data from a PDF into a spreadsheet.

Pros:

  • No tools required
  • Works for very small datasets

Cons:

  • Time-consuming
  • Prone to errors
  • Poor formatting retention

This method is only practical for small, simple files.

2. Using Spreadsheet Software

Tools like Excel and Google Sheets offer built-in import features.

Steps for how to convert a PDF into a CSV file:

  1. Open Excel or Google Sheets
  2. Import the PDF file
  3. Adjust table formatting
  4. Export as CSV

This is a common solution for users learning how to convert PDF to CSV format without additional software.

3. Using Online Tools

Online converters are a popular choice for quick tasks.

Benefits:

  • Easy to use
  • No installation required
  • Many offer a PDF to CSV converter

Risks:

  • File size limitations
  • Privacy concerns with sensitive data

These tools are convenient when you need to convert a PDF to CSV quickly.

4. Using AI-Powered Tools

AI-powered solutions are transforming how we convert a PDF file to CSV.

Advantages:

  • Higher accuracy in table detection
  • Faster processing times
  • Ability to handle complex or scanned PDFs

These tools are ideal for large datasets or documents with complicated layouts.

Step-by-Step Guide: How to Convert PDF to CSV

If you're wondering how to convert a PDF to CSV, follow these simple steps:

Step-by-Step Guide: How to Convert PDF to CSV
  1. Upload or import your PDF: Use your preferred tool (software or online platform)
  2. Select CSV as the output format: Choose the correct export option
  3. Adjust extraction settings: Ensure tables and structured data are properly detected
  4. Download and verify the output: Check for formatting issues or missing data

This process works for most tools and ensures a smooth convert PDF file to CSV workflow.

Boost Your Productivity with Smallppt

While it’s important to convert a PDF to CSV, the real value comes from how you use that data.

This is where Smallppt stands out.

Smallppt is an AI-powered productivity tool designed to streamline your creative workflow. After organizing your data using a CSV format, Smallppt helps you transform raw data into compelling presentations, infographics, and structured reports.

Instead of manually building slides, you can instantly generate professional visuals that communicate insights clearly. It effectively bridges the gap between data extraction and impactful storytelling—making it an excellent companion after you turn PDF into CSV.

Your Ideas, Our Slides
Turn your thoughts into professional presentations in seconds with Smallppt.

Tips for Accurate PDF to CSV Conversion

To ensure the best results when you convert a PDF to CSV, follow these best practices:

Tips for Accurate PDF to CSV Conversion
  • Use high-quality PDFs: Avoid blurry or low-resolution scans
  • Apply OCR for scanned documents: This helps extract text accurately
  • Clean and validate your data: Check for formatting errors or missing values
  • Choose the right tool: Select tools based on file complexity and sensitivity

FAQs

Q1. Why is the table I extracted with pdfplumber messy, and the rows and columns don't match?

In most cases, it is because the tables in PDF are not "real tables" (such as hand-drawn with spaces or lines), or there are merged cells, rows, and columns.

  • Try to adjust the parameters first: vertical_strategy="lines "or" text ".
  • Switch to Camelot (for tables with borders) or Tabula (for tables with text alignment)
  • When it is extremely irregular, it can only be cleaned manually or recognized by OCR first.

Q2. Can a scanned PDF (picture format) be directly converted to CSV with these tools?

No. Common libraries (pdfplumber, tabula, camelot) only support text PDF. The scanned version must be OCR first.

Recommended combination: pdf2image+pytesseract (or easyocr) recognizes text and table structure, and then turns to CSV.

You can also directly use commercial tools with OCR (Adobe Acrobat Pro, ABBYY FineReader).

Q3. My PDF has dozens of pages, and each table has the same structure. How can I export a CSV in batches?

Read the tables on each page circularly and merge them vertically with pandas. concat ().

Note: If each page has a header, duplicate header lines need to be deleted after the merger.

Q4. Is there a free conversion tool that beginners can use without writing code?

Yes, I recommend:

  • Tabula (open source, providing a graphical interface, available on Windows/Mac)
  • ILovePDF, Smallpdf (online tools, simple forms are free, but the file size is limited)
  • Adobe Acrobat online edition (the best effect, but for a fee)

Note: Do not upload sensitive PDFs to online tools.

Conclusion

Whether you're handling financial records, reports, or large datasets, knowing how to convert PDF to CSV can save time and improve efficiency.

By choosing the right method—manual, software-based, or AI-powered—you can easily convert a PDF file to CSV and unlock the full potential of your data.

And once your data is ready, tools like Smallppt help you take the next step—turning raw information into impactful presentations and insights.

Tags
Visit Smallppt and learn more!
Innovate, Speed, Meet Quality.
On this surprising Smallppt, let's discover more together!
Try free
Related posts on our blog
Make your ideas real
Real-time online editingGenerate slides in one minuteUnlimited access to a vast template libraryTurn ideas into stunning slides instantlySmart layouts, auto-designed for impactSave hours with AI-powered productivityYour content, beautifully presentedReal-time online editingGenerate slides in one minuteUnlimited access to a vast template libraryTurn ideas into stunning slides instantlySmart layouts, auto-designed for impactSave hours with AI-powered productivityYour content, beautifully presented
Free AI generation